"Drink plenty of fluids, avoid outdoor activity during peak hours": VMMC professor advises precautions amid heatwave
New Delhi, May 24 -- Professor of Community Medicine at VMMC and Safdarjung Hospital, V P Gautam, on Sunday advised people to take precautionary measures amid the prevailing heatwave conditions, including staying hydrated, consuming natural drinks such as shikanji and lassi and avoiding outdoor activities during peak afternoon hours.
Speaking to ANI, Gautam said there has been a rise in cases of heat-related illness (HRI) during the summer season and cautioned that such conditions could range from mild symptoms to life-threatening complications if timely care is not provided.
